About This Book

The narrative traces the intersecting personal and political lives of an admired but hesitant parliamentarian and the ambitious figures who try to shape his career. Through episodes of social intrigue, financial pressure, romantic complication, and concealed motives, allies and rivals maneuver to gain influence while private secrets emerge. The action shifts from private conversations to public contests, journalistic intervention, and strategic gambits, examining duty, conscience, and the clash between personal loyalty and political expediency. Reversals, betrayals, and sacrifices compel characters to confront the costs of ambition and to make consequential choices about honor, love, and public reputation.

About the Author

Oppenheim, E. Phillips portrait

E. Phillips Oppenheim

E. Phillips Oppenheim was a prolific English novelist known for his contributions to the genre of thriller and adventure fiction in the early 20th century. His works often explore themes of intrigue, politics, and romance, reflecting the complexities of human nature and society. Among his notable titles are "A Lost Leader," which delves into political ambition, and "A Millionaire of Yesterday," a tale of wealth and its implications. Oppenheim's storytelling is characterized by engaging plots and well-drawn characters, making him a popular figure in his time and a significant part of literary heritage.
